A QUICK READ

What the numbers say about Connecticut State Community College

What does Connecticut State Community College cost?

Connecticut State Community College reports an average annual net price of $11,513 after grants and scholarships. This is an institution-wide average, not an individual aid offer.

What do Connecticut State Community College graduates earn?

The observed median earnings figure is $49,819 5 years after completion. It describes a federal cohort, not a guaranteed starting salary.

How much federal debt do Connecticut State Community College graduates have?

Completer borrowers report median cumulative federal student debt of $9,200. Parent PLUS and private loans are not included.

Is every degree at Connecticut State Community College worth the same?

No. DegreeVerdict currently shows 38 field-and-credential outcomes at Connecticut State Community College; reported earnings and debt can differ substantially by program category.
